Output 0744bd3bbe3e504d25603acd57d12cc7267ce8d9be085515af4d0b8a9ba68fb1:1

value
2622667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3adc81157e8db0d0d0df471aa72766ef2f60774e OP_EQUAL
address
374FGaAqRYGhGaukj3y6UXoGFaEmCRENXw
transaction
0744bd3bbe3e504d25603acd57d12cc7267ce8d9be085515af4d0b8a9ba68fb1
confirmations
358598
spent
true